1. Fulbright Foreign Student Program

The Fulbright Foreign Student Program is one of the most prestigious scholarship programs in the world. It provides full funding for graduate-level students, young professionals, and artists to study and conduct research in the United States. The program covers tuition, airfare, a living stipend, and health insurance.

2. Chevening Scholarships

Funded by the UK government, Chevening Scholarships are awarded to outstanding professionals from all over the world to pursue a one-year master’s degree in any subject at any UK university. The scholarship covers tuition fees, travel expenses, and a living allowance.

3. Erasmus Mundus Joint Master Degrees (EMJMD)

The Erasmus Mundus Joint Master Degrees (EMJMD) are highly competitive scholarships offered to students from all over the world to study in various European countries. These scholarships cover tuition fees, travel costs, and a monthly allowance for living expenses throughout the duration of the program.

4. Australia Awards Scholarships

Offered by the Australian government, Australia Awards Scholarships aim to contribute to the development needs of partner countries. These scholarships provide full tuition fees, return air travel, an establishment allowance, and a living allowance for eligible applicants to undertake undergraduate or postgraduate study at participating Australian institutions.

5. DAAD Scholarships

Funded by the German government, the German Academic Exchange Service (DAAD) offers a wide range of scholarships for international students to study in Germany. These scholarships cater to graduate students, doctoral candidates, and post-docs and cover tuition, living expenses, travel costs, and health insurance.

6. Japan’s MEXT Scholarships

Japan’s Ministry of Education, Culture, Sports, Science and Technology (MEXT) offers full scholarships for research students, undergraduate students, and specialized training college students. These scholarships include tuition, travel expenses, and a monthly allowance.
